Southwestern Black Bean Stew

Savory taco beef stew with corn and black beans, topped with sour cream and cheddar.
Ingredients:
  • 1 pound ground beef
  • 1 (1.25 ounce) package taco seasoning mix
  • 1 (15 ounce) can whole kernel corn, drained
  • 1 (15 ounce) can black beans, undrained
  • 1 (6 ounce) can tomato paste
  • 1.5 cups water
  • 0.5 cup sour cream
  • 2 (8 ounce) packages shredded Cheddar cheese
Instructions:
  • In a large skillet over medium high heat, cook the ground beef until browned. Drain the excess fat. Stir in taco seasoning and simmer covered on low heat for 10 minutes.
  • Start by gently layering the corn, beans, tomato paste, and water in a slow cooker. Stir until well combined. Next, add the seasoned meat and sour cream. Increase heat to high and simmer for 20 minutes. Serve in bowls and top with shredded cheddar cheese for a delightful finish.
